SpletSemi-weekly depositors have at least three business days following the close of the semi-weekly period by which to deposit employment taxes accumulated during the semi-weekly period. Business days include every calendar day other than Saturdays, Sundays, or legal holidays in the District of Columbia under section 7503. Splet29. nov. 2024 · Payroll taxes are paid to the IRS either semi-weekly or monthly, based on the total amount of payroll taxes you owe. If you have only a few employees and a small payroll tax liability, you pay monthly; if you have many employees and a more significant payroll tax liability, you pay semi-weekly. Note
